¿Debería Bilal Jalook continuar con la programación?

Respuesta corta: sí, absolutamente.

Respuesta larga: sí, absolutamente. Por lo que parece, has aprendido un poco en varios lenguajes de programación diferentes. A diferencia de aprender bien un idioma.

Mi consejo sería:

Quédate con un idioma y aprende bien . Elija el idioma según el que más le guste y el que necesite usar para las tareas. Si el material académico y los cursos en línea no funcionan para usted, pruebe diferentes medios de aprendizaje, tales como: libros, videos y enseñanza individualizada.

Cuando te quedes atascado, investiga. No solo intentes hacerlo funcionar, investiga el problema y aprende sobre él. Lea sobre esto, mire videos, etc., lo que sea que lo ayude a comprenderlo.

Cuando te quedes atascado, analiza el problema: creo que esto me ayuda a abordar un problema complejo. Cuando estoy programando, divido el problema en sus respectivos fragmentos y trazo el problema. A veces, escribir o dibujar un problema lo ayudará a comprenderlo con mayor detalle.

Eche un vistazo a estas dos páginas también. Contienen algunos de los libros de programación e informática más recomendados.

  • ¿Cuál es el libro más influyente que todo programador debería leer?
  • Libros de idiomas / Tutoriales para idiomas populares

¡Ojalá esta información te ayude! ¡No te rindas!

Debes seguir programando, pero reducir el lenguaje establecido y mejorar con uno o dos. Parece que solo necesita más experiencia en la programación real (no la parte del código sino la parte de resolución de problemas). Después de un tiempo, ha aprendido sobre patrones de diseño y algoritmos y la resolución de esos problemas se vuelve más fácil.

Como ya se ha dicho, mientras aprende, el alcance de los idiomas se limita a lo que necesita para completar el curso. Si se sobrecarga con un montón de material nuevo de una sola vez, habrá una tendencia a mezclar un poco los detalles, lo que disminuirá su productividad.

En cuanto a la entrega tardía de las tareas, busque siempre recursos que lo ayuden a resolver los problemas que está encontrando. ¡¡¡Google es tu amigo!!! Eso no significa que literalmente tome las soluciones que encuentre en línea y copie y pegue. ¡No! Comprenda el concepto, luego aplíquelo.

Si te gusta la programación, definitivamente continúa. Ha habido muchos momentos en mi carrera en los que he considerado alejarme y hacer otra cosa. Entonces recuerdo lo aburrida que me siento con casi todo lo demás. La programación me mantiene pensando, incluso cuando las cosas se vuelven un poco repetitivas.

¿Debo continuar con la programación?

Estudiando programación de juegos en un instituto, aprendí C ++, C #, Java, además de Unreal Engine, Unity, Qt, Android Studo. Uso SoloLearn y Udemy para aprender aún más de lo que tengo en el instituto. cada vez que recibo una tarea o tarea, me atoro y termino al no terminarla o entregar tarde

Aquí está mi suposición: Te falta experiencia. Y ganas experiencia resolviendo problemas.

Depende de usted si desea continuar o no, pero para mí no mencionó una razón para detener la programación, sino un problema común que todos tienen y que no desarrollaron aplicaciones del mundo real que se utilizan en un entorno de producción. empresa.

Realmente solo tú puedes responder esa pregunta. Puedo decirle que hay suficientes recursos por ahí que no debería haber ninguna razón para quedarse atascado. Usa esos recursos. 9 de cada 10 veces la pregunta ha sido respondida en sitios como desbordamiento de pila o la comunidad la responderá por usted. Mantener la cabeza en alto. Yo diría que no te rindas, no importa lo frustrado que estés.

More Interesting

Parece que no tengo un mapa claro de la estructura de carpetas de Node y Express. ¿Qué debo hacer para entender Nodo y Javascript en general?

Tenía mi sitio web desarrollado en el extranjero. ¿Qué debe probarse durante una auditoría para determinar si fue desarrollada por buenos estándares y directrices de codificación?

Acabo de comenzar a aprender desarrollo web, ¿qué idiomas debo aprender y cuál es el alcance de la carrera en este campo?

Quiero construir un sistema de chat que pueda servir a miles de personas en el mismo canal mientras que aloje varios canales que también puedan albergar la misma cantidad. Conozco los conceptos básicos de la programación del servidor en Java, pero no estoy seguro de qué técnica debo usar para permitir tantas conexiones.

Cómo agregar un formulario de suscriptor a mi sitio web pero sin enviar un correo de confirmación a la identificación del suscriptor

Quiero usar el resultado de una consulta en SQL como una tabla y agregarlo a la base de datos para poder usar esta tabla para ejecutar otra consulta. ¿Cómo lo hago?

Soy un estudiante de ingeniería mecatrónica, también estoy interesado en el desarrollo web. ¿Es una pérdida de tiempo tomar el desarrollo web como una carrera secundaria?

Quiero invertir los próximos 6 meses en aprender Ruby on Rails. ¿Cómo debería ser mi plan de estudio?

Aprendí C y ahora quiero crear un sitio web como la forma más simple de Twitter usando Python. ¿Qué libros de Python me recomendarías?

¿Vale la pena aprender MEAN stack para el desarrollo web (tengo 20 años)?

Quiero crear un sitio web de reservas, ¿cómo debo hacerlo?

¿Qué tipo de sitio web debo hacer? Quiero un sitio que permita a las personas publicar su experiencia sobre un tema determinado. ¿Es este un blog o qué?

¿Cómo creo y diseño mi sitio?

Tengo un sitio web (http://awomkenneth.com/). Me gustaría hacerlo más popular en Nigeria. ¿Cómo lo logro?

Estoy estudiando ingeniería de software y también desarrollo de backend. Estoy rodeado de personas que piensan que los desarrolladores de backend ganan menos. ¿Les creeré?